As reactions 68 and 69 above exemplify, the substitution of the allylsilane usually takes place with an allylic shift (Se2 ). This can be synthetically useful, for example in the isomerization of allyl sulphones 123 to vinyl sulphones 124 (equation 74)145. The reaction is also highly stereospecific (>90% E) (vide infra). [Pg.402]

The perfluorinated resiri sulphonic acid trimethylsilyl ester (66 Nafion-TMS ) has been developed as a new silylating agent for alcohols, phenols, etc7 The substrate and resin are shaken in dichloromethane at room temperature, with triethylamine if necessary, before the resin is simply removed by filtration from the solution of products. The trimethylsilylation of tertiary alcohols with trimethylsilyl chloride-triethylamine has been found to be catalysed by various additives, including DMSO and HMPT. Allylsilanes have been used as new silylating reagents for alcohols in the presence of an acid catalyst [equation (19)] trimethylsilyl and t-butyldimethylsilyl (TBDMS) ethers can be made in this way. [Pg.167]

Silicon.— Allylsilanes are outstandingly useful carbon nucleophiles as a result of their ability to react with electrophiles in a controlled and specific manner to form new carbon-carbon bonds. Furthermore, metallation to give a-(trimethyl-silyl)allylic carbanions introduces the possibility of an additional level of control over the mode of attack (either a or y) exhibited by the allylsilane. It is not surprising, therefore, to find the chemistry of these species occupying a prominent position in this year s organosilicon literature, and in addition to the many applications reported some new routes to these compounds have been described.
